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ate
The NM_003490.4(SYN3):c.1465C>T(p.Arg489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000886 in 1,613,754 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R489G) has been classified as Uncertain significance.

The c.1465C>T (p.R489W) alteration is located in exon 12 (coding exon 12) of the SYN3 gene. This alteration results from a C to T substitution at nucleotide position 1465, causing the arginine (R) at amino acid position 489 to be replaced by a tryptophan (W).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
